The Worldwide Bi-metallic Collectors Club has developed
encased coins
commemorating official WBCC representation at the
World Money Fair, in
Basel, Switzerland, and the American Numismatic Association,
Coin Fair in
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, USA..
The four coins selected for this project are;
Australia, 1999, 5 Cents
Canada, 2000, Cent
Netherlands, 2000, 25 Cents
USA, 2000, Cent.
The production run includes approximately 150 specimens
of each coin.
Actual minting will begin on Friday, 21 July 2000.
